John Kerry Says GOP Lies

John Kerry is making the circuit for the upcoming election and is stumping for members of his party. He is also preparing for the 2008 Presidential race but like Hillary, he is not openly acknowledging that fact. On the stump Kerry said the GOP lied about Foley. lied about Iraq and lied about the problems with North Korea.

“A lie, a lie, a lie, a lie. What we have in Washington is a house of lies, and in November, we need to clean house,” Kerry, D-Mass., said Friday night during the New Hampshire Democratic Party’s annual fall fundraising[sic] dinner.

“They tell us we’re making progress in Iraq and that there is no civil war. That is a lie,” he said. “It’s immoral to lie about progress in that war in order to get through a news cycle or an election cycle.” Access North GA
